Summary of differences between Steak and Brisket
- Brisket has less Vitamin B6, Vitamin B2, Selenium, Vitamin B3, and Monounsaturated Fat than Steak.
- Steak covers your daily need of Vitamin B6 17% more than Brisket.
- Steak has 2 times more Vitamin B2 than Brisket. While Steak has 0.301mg of Vitamin B2, Brisket has only 0.171mg.
- Brisket has less Saturated Fat.
These are the specific foods used in this comparison Beef, rib eye steak, boneless, lip off, separable lean and fat, trimmed to 0" fat, all grades, cooked, grilled and Beef, brisket, flat half, separable lean and fat, trimmed to 1/8" fat, all grades, cooked, braised.

Comparison summary
Which food is lower in Cholesterol?

Steak is lower in Cholesterol (difference - 28mg)
Which food contains less Sodium?

Brisket contains less Sodium (difference - 10mg)
Which food is lower in Saturated Fat?

Brisket is lower in Saturated Fat (difference - 1.138g)
Which food is cheaper?

Brisket is cheaper (difference - $0.4)
